先用命令vim sjdm.txt打开一个编辑窗口,把名字粘贴进去。
张三
李四
王五
老六
然后输入 :wq! 保存退出
编写shell脚本
vim sxsjdm.txt 进去配置文件
clear
for i in {1..4}
do
num=$[$RANDOM%4+1]
name=`sed -n ${num}p sjdm.txt`
echo
echo -e '\t\t+-------------+'
echo -e '\t\t|\t\t\t\t\t|'
echo -e '\t\t|\t\t'$name'\t\t\t|'
echo -e '\t\t|\t\t\t\t\t|'
echo -e '\t\t--------------+'
echo
sleep 1
if [ $i -lt 4 ];then
clear
fi
done
read -p "退出请回车"
:wq!保存退出
bash sxsjdm.txt 执行
到这里随机点名就已经实现了。